Vinnie Sablan says he’ll seek CNMI GOP nomination for governor in 2026

Letter to party chair Patrick Cepeda signals Republican field taking shape ahead of the 2026 general election.
SAIPAN — Former Senator Vinnie Vinson Flores Sablan said Monday he intends to seek the Republican Party’s nomination for governor in the 2026 general election, formally notifying CNMI GOP President Patrick M. Cepeda in a letter dated Nov. 10. In the letter, Sablan frames his run around “stability, accountability and prosperity,” and pledges to prioritize jobs, schools, health care and fiscal transparency.
Rep. Joel Castro Camacho launches 2026 bid for Saipan mayor, pledges islandwide beautification and “lead-by-example” service

SAIPAN — Four-term Precinct 4 Rep. Joel Castro Camacho formally announced he will run for Saipan mayor in 2026, saying the job’s resources would let him scale the hands-on cleanup and safety projects his office has carried out for years.
